Hollow Knight: Silksong, the highly anticipated sequel to the acclaimed indie hit Hollow Knight, has finally made waves once again, this time at gamescom 2025. With the excitement palpable among fans eager to revisit Hallownest in a new light, the game has provided insights into its gameplay mechanics through off-screen footage showcasing two notable levels: Moss Grove and Deep Docks. Although many fans couldn’t attend the event, we’ve uncovered 10 minutes of gameplay demonstrating the fluidity and depth that Silksong promises.

#### Moss Grove

The first level showcased, Moss Grove, is a lush, sprawling forest environment teeming with various creatures and enemies. The background imagery is rich in greenery, accentuated by a poetic mix of light and shadow that creates an atmospheric experience. The gameplay highlights Hornet’s remarkable agility, allowing her to climb and dart through the environment seamlessly.

One striking aspect of Moss Grove is the introduction of new enemy types that elevate combat strategies, compelling players to adapt to Hornet’s rapid movements and adapt their attack patterns. The level design promotes exploration and discovery, rewarding players who take the time to navigate its nooks and crannies.

#### Boss Encounter: Moss Mother

Arguably one of the standout moments in the gameplay is the boss encounter against the Moss Mother. This formidable foe presents a significant challenge, requiring players to balance offensive and defensive strategies. The fight itself is dynamic, with fluid animations and intricate attack patterns that keep players on their toes. The visuals amplify the tension, with the Moss Mother commanding the space around her, creating an engaging duel that recalls the thrilling boss battles of the original Hollow Knight.

The design of the Moss Mother further emphasizes Hornet’s theme of nature versus purity, as she seems to embody the essence of the Moss Grove level. The fight is not merely a test of strength; it encourages players to appreciate the mechanics and design that underpin this fantastical world.

#### Deep Docks

Transitioning into the Deep Docks level, players encounter a dramatically different environment. The dark, industrial wasteland contrasts sharply with the radiant beauty of Moss Grove. Here, Hornet’s acrobatics and combat skills shine even brighter, as she maneuvers around obstacles and engages with new enemy types that emerge from the shadows.

The tension builds as Hornet navigates through intricate platforms and hidden pathways that make up the Deep Docks. This level showcases the game’s emphasis on exploration, luring players deeper into its world with a promise of secrets waiting to be uncovered. As she fights her way through the docks, players can appreciate the level’s design—each area feels meticulously crafted to enhance engagement and immersion.
